Analytik Jena is a TOP Apprenticeship company for 2025

Award honors Analytik Jena's long-standing commitment to sustainable and successful education for young people

Jena, February 20, 2025 – Analytik Jena, along with six other companies, has been awarded the title of “TOP Apprenticeship Company 2025” by the East Thuringia Chamber of Industry and Commerce. The award recognizes Analytik Jena’s long-standing commitment to the sustainable and successful training of young people. The training concept impresses with its practical relevance and active involvement of the trainees.

Since 1993, more than 180 trainees have successfully completed their training at Analytik Jena. With its analytical measurement and automation technology, the Jena-based, internationally active company makes an important contribution to improving the quality of life in many areas. This is becoming increasingly important to young people and, above all, they are becoming more and more aware of it. In addition, the practical apprenticeship concept and the friendly atmosphere are convincing factors – starting with the application process and the trial work day.

In particular, Analytik Jena stands out from the competition for qualified young talent thanks to its comprehensive, structured, and personally supervised training program. Targeted exam preparation is an important criterion in this regard. In addition, trainees appreciate that they are integrated as team members from the outset and actively involved in everyday work. Their opinions are regularly heard, for example at trainee get-togethers or recurring feedback sessions. Practical trainee projects enable them to actively shape their training and make a meaningful contribution.

Head of Apprenticeship Vicktoria Barth is delighted with the award: “We have produced several best-in-class trainees. This would not be possible without our dedicated trainers, because training is teamwork. With the support of the Chamber of Industry and Commerce, the East Thuringian Training Association, and the Jena Education Center, we offer solid training. The diverse career paths of former trainees confirm time and again that you can go far with us.”

Grit Petzholdt-Gühne, Vice President Human Resources, is also delighted with this prestigious recognition: "For us at Analytik Jena, our commitment to providing excellent apprenticeships is, on the one hand, an important investment in the future. On the other hand, we want to fulfill our social responsibility and give young people a solid start to their careers. As a rule, apprenticeships are followed by a job offer, and our Learning & Development team continues to support our talented employees. "

A total of 16 instructors and eight apprenticeship coordinators ensure mutual success. The range of apprenticeships covers a wide spectrum:
- Industrial clerk (m/f/d)
- Office management clerk (m/f/d)
- Wholesale and foreign trade management clerk (m/f/d) FR: Foreign trade
- Warehouse logistics specialist (m/f/d)
- Industrial mechanic (m/f/d)
- IT specialist (m/f/d) FR: System integration or application development
- Electronics technician for devices and systems (m/f/d)
- Technical product designer (m/f/d) FR: Machine and plant design

In addition, more than seven dual study programs can be taken.
